We’ve decided to revert the drop rate change for 10-player heroic Firelands completely. We’ll also be slightly buffing the drop rates in 10-player normal. In the end, we should get the following results:
• 25-player heroic has 44% lower drop rates in phase 3 relative to 4.2 launch.
• 25-player normal remains unchanged from 4.2 launch.
• 10-player heroic remains unchanged from 4.2 launch.
• 10-player normal has 33% higher drop rates in phase 3 relative to 4.2 launch.
We plan to hotfix the new rates into place as soon as possible, and we should see them in-place pre-raid this evening barring unforeseen complications.
